Obituary for Geraldine Gladys Hopkins (Hicks)

Geraldine Gladys  Hopkins (Hicks)
Hopkins, Geraldine Gladys
At Hastings Manor in her 89th year, Geraldine passed away peacefully with family by her side. Daughter of the late Harry and Bernice Hicks. Loving wife of the late George Hopkins. Dear Mom to Rosemary Brown (Richard), Lynn Large (Gilbert), Sherri McCarten (Jim), Don Hopkins (Lynda), the late Dennis Hopkins and late David Hopkins. Sister to the late Glen Hicks. Loving Grandmother to Dennis, Bobbi Ann, Melanie, Tracey, Corey, Dawn and the late Lisa. Great grandmother to 18 wonderful great grandchildren.
For the past 6 years, Gerry has resided on the Pine Villa at Hastings Manor LTC. Her children are very thankful for the loving care that she received from the staff. Mom was so blessed to have made so many caring new friendships. We are especially thankful to Bonnie for her devoted love & support to Mom and her daughters. A Loving protector of her family, she always enjoyed her Sunday drives, attending to her beautiful flower gardens, preparing amazing dinners and travelling with family to create lasting memories. Mom, we will always cherish the memories we have shared with you over the years; you taught us well. Go in peace to be with Dad in Heaven.
